This is an all-in-one employee directory and automated onboarding system. A single button click automated a complex onboarding process using Zapier. There are 7,000+ different apps you can integrate with to fully customize and automate employee onboarding.
This template uses Zapier Tables and Workflows (Zaps). It includes the employee directory table with all the necessary personal information you need for your employees like phone numbers, job titles, employee name, office location, email addresses, and employment status with the ability to customize and add more fields. Simply start adding employees.
The automated onboarding workflow starts when you click a button. It will find and add employees to your onboarding event in Google Calendar, add them to your Zapier account, send a team message in Slack, and send a checklist email to your new hire.
Two other automated workflows handle the reminders by transforming date fields into month-day fields to reference each year and send you a reminder email when an employee has a work anniversary or birthday.
